原生的vi還是不太好用的,不支持小鍵盤,默認(rèn)不換行,所以推薦你用vim,功能要強(qiáng)大的多。另外,可以在IDE中安裝vim插件,這樣的話,練習(xí)久了自然對vim的常用命令十分熟悉了。寫代碼的話,還是不建議用vim,雖然也有提示,但是畢竟不是IDE,現(xiàn)在都是大型項(xiàng)目,多人合作,別人都是IDE,你用vim裝逼,會不會被打我不知道,但是肯定風(fēng)格不太統(tǒng)一。
我選Scala。就語言本身來說,scala無疑是大師級的作品。語法糖這類東西就不說了吧(聽說過的語法糖scala中都有),其中的函數(shù)式編程、可變/不可變數(shù)據(jù)集、Actor式并發(fā)等等都是理論界最前衛(wèi)概念的實(shí)踐,根據(jù)scala的數(shù)據(jù)處理理念和模式開發(fā)出的AKKA、Spark、Kafka等性能更是帥到?jīng)]朋友。Scala硬是靠一己之力把jvm拉進(jìn)了數(shù)據(jù)科學(xué)的殿堂。
其實(shí)前端編程的軟件很多,但是初學(xué)的話,建議還是以熟悉標(biāo)簽和屬性為主,不需要太多的自動補(bǔ)全功能,一個(gè)簡單的記事本就行,后期熟悉后,再使用相關(guān)編程軟件,提高開發(fā)效率,下面我簡單介紹幾個(gè)不錯(cuò)的前端網(wǎng)頁編程軟件,感興趣的朋友可以下載嘗試一下:1.VS Code:這個(gè)軟件大部分開發(fā)人員都應(yīng)該聽說或使用過,微軟開發(fā)的一個(gè)免費(fèi)、開源、跨平臺的代碼編輯器,插件擴(kuò)展豐富,支持常見的語法提示、代碼高亮、自動補(bǔ)全、Gi...
暫無介紹